Seven Region Partition (Posted on 2017-05-27) Difficulty: 3 of 5
The diameter of a polygon is defined as the longest distance between any pair of vertices of the polygon.

Partition a unit equilateral triangle into seven regions so that all seven regions have the same polygon diameter.

How small can that diameter be made?

Solution: (Hide)
This arrangement has diameter D = (sqrt(3) - 1)/2 ~= 0.366

Draw the three altitudes for each side.
Draw three circles of radius D, one centered at each triangle vertex. Each circle will intersect two sides and one altitude.
For each circle, draw the two segments joining the point on the altitude to the two points on the sides. This forms 3 kites.
Finally, draw the three segments from the three interior points. This forms 3 trapezoids and an equilateral triangle in the center.

Each kite has two sides and both diagonals equal to D. The central triangle has sides equal to D. Each trapezoid has its longer base and both diagonals equal to D.
